WasmGPU.colormap.fromStops

Summary

WasmGPU.colormap.fromStops creates or retrieves a colormap definition used for scalar-to-color mapping.

Syntax

WasmGPU.colormap.fromStops(stops: ReadonlyArray<ColormapStop>, desc: ColormapDescriptor = {}): Colormap
const result = wgpu.colormap.fromStops(stops, desc);

Parameters

Name Type Required Description
stops ReadonlyArray<ColormapStop> Yes Colormap stops used to generate a sampled LUT.
desc ColormapDescriptor = {} Yes Descriptor object that controls colormap resolution/filter/color space.

Returns

Colormap - Colormap runtime object for scalar-to-color mapping on CPU and GPU paths.

Type Details

ColormapStop

type ColormapStop = Color4 | { t: number; color: Color4; };

ColormapDescriptor

type ColormapDescriptor = {

    resolution?: number;

    filter?: ColormapFilter;

    colorSpace?: "srgb" | "linear";

};

ColormapDescriptor Fields

Name Type Required Description
resolution number No Numeric input controlling resolution for this operation.
filter ColormapFilter No Filtering mode used for colormap or sampler lookups.
colorSpace "srgb" \| "linear" No Color-space mode used by this conversion or lookup.

Color4

type Color4 = [number, number, number, number];

ColormapFilter

type ColormapFilter = "linear" | "nearest";

Example

const canvas = document.querySelector("canvas");
const wgpu = await WasmGPU.create(canvas);

const stops = [{ t: 0, color: [0, 0, 0, 1] }, { t: 1, color: [1, 1, 1, 1] }];
const desc = { resolution: 256, filter: "linear", colorSpace: "srgb" };
const result = wgpu.colormap.fromStops(stops, desc);
console.log(result);
console.log(result.sampleCPU(0.5));
